Precisely what is six-MAPB?
six-MAPB, or 6-(2-methylaminopropyl)benzofuran, can be a artificial empathogen and entactogen. It is chemically relevant to both of those MDMA (3,4-methylenedioxymethamphetamine) and 6-APB (six-(two-aminopropyl)benzofuran), and it shares similar effects. 6-MAPB belongs to your benzofuran class of compounds, characterized by a benzene ring fused to your furan ring.

Empathogens and entactogens are substances noted for their power to market feelings of psychological closeness, empathy, and social bonding. These outcomes make six-MAPB preferred in recreational settings, specifically at audio festivals, functions, and raves.

Chemical Framework and Pharmacology
The chemical composition of six-MAPB features a benzofuran ring method using a methylaminopropyl aspect chain. This framework lets it to connect with serotonin receptors inside the Mind, specifically the serotonin transporter (SERT). By inhibiting the reuptake of serotonin, six-MAPB raises the amounts of this neurotransmitter within the synaptic cleft, resulting in enhanced mood and emotions of euphoria.

In combination with its consequences on serotonin, 6-MAPB also influences dopamine and norepinephrine degrees, contributing to its stimulant Attributes. The mixed action on these neurotransmitter systems ends in a complex psychoactive profile that can vary considerably involving end users.

Authorized Standing
The authorized standing of six-MAPB differs broadly throughout diverse international locations and locations. In a few destinations, it is assessed for a managed compound, while in Other people, it exists inside a legal gray area.

United States: six-MAPB is not really precisely stated being a controlled substance under federal law. Having said that, it could be regarded an analogue of MDMA beneath the Federal Analogue Act, creating its sale, possession, or distribution for human consumption unlawful.
Uk: 6-MAPB is classified as a category B drug beneath the Misuse of Medicines Act, making it unlawful to have, distribute, or manufacture.
Australia: The substance is listed for a Plan 9 prohibited compound, indicating it is prohibited to possess, use, or distribute.
copyright: six-MAPB is just not explicitly scheduled, but it could be thought of an analogue of managed substances under more info the Controlled Prescription drugs and Substances Act.
Supplied the variability in legal position, men and women considering six-MAPB need to completely investigate the rules in their precise jurisdiction to prevent lawful repercussions.
